The tooth replacement process of Shiba Inu:

About 20 days: the dog starts to grow teeth.

4 to 6 weeks old: The dog’s milk incisors are all the same.

When a dog is close to 2 months old, all of its deciduous teeth are straight, white, thin and pointed.

2 to 4 months old: The dog replaces the first deciduous incisor.

5 to 6 months old: The dog begins to replace the second and third deciduous incisors and deciduous canines.

After 8 months of age: all dogs have permanent teeth.

Precautions for Shiba Inu teeth changing:

1. Improve Shiba Inu’s diet

During the teeth changing period, Shiba Inu will feel pain and appetite will be higher than It usually decreases a lot. In addition, it is difficult to chew food during the teething period, which increases the burden on the gastrointestinal tract, which can easily lead to gastrointestinal indigestion, thus making the Shiba Inu's appetite even worse. The pet owner can no longer feed it as before, but can enrich its diet structure, make the food delicious, stimulate the Shiba Inu's appetite, and make it appetite. Therefore, pet owners can add some easy-to-chew and delicious food to dog food, such as egg yolks, shredded chicken breast, tofu or vegetables, etc. If the pet owner usually makes homemade food for the Shiba Inu, he can cook some lean meat porridge, millet porridge, chicken porridge, vegetable porridge, etc. for the Shiba Inu.

2. Feed digestion powder

Since it is not easy to chew food during the teething period, food that is not chewed into pieces will be difficult to digest, resulting in Shiba Inu's stomach ache. There is accumulated food in it. When this happens to the Shiba Inu, it is also one of the reasons for its poor appetite. Therefore, pet owners can first fast for half a day or one day to see if the Shiba Inu is better. If the situation still does not improve, then they can feed it some digestive powder to increase its intestinal digestive enzymes and beneficial bacteria.
